When the air pressure is outside the specified range, adjust in the
following procedures.
When the values of “B VACUUM FAN DUTY(PLAIN-M)” and “T
BLOWER FAN DUTY (PLAIN-M)” in Sim4-11 are changed, they
are reflected to the measured value of the above Sim4-3.
By increasing the vacuum fan duty and the blower fan duty values
in the simulation, the suction pressure is increased.
(The vacuum fan duty and the blower fan duty values must be
changed to the same value. Example: When B is 60, make T 60.)
Since the blowing pressure is also increased, be sure to check
the blowing pressure after adjustment of the suction pressure.
By decreasing the vacuum fan duty and the blower fan duty val-
ues in the simulation, the suction pressure is decreased.
(The vacuum fan duty and the blower fan duty values must be
changed to the same value. Example: When B is 40, make T 40.)
Since the blowing pressure is also decreased, be sure to check
the blowing pressure after adjustment of the suction pressure.
